Banana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ting

bananacakebrownbuttercreamcheesefrostingThis is the best easy, moist banana cake recipe and it's made completely from scratch. My recipe is perfectly balanced with extra bananas and complementary spices and it's crowned with a silky smooth cream cheese frosting. This is the snack cake of your dreams.

Banana Cake:
¾ cup unsalted butter, softened to room temperature (170 g)
¾ cup Canola or vegetable oil (175 mL)
1 cup Erythritol Gold (200 g)
½ cup Monk Fruit Sweetener with Erythritol (Granular) (100 g)
2 cups ripe bananas, well-mashed (~ 4 bananas) (470 g)
2 large eggs, room temperature preferred
¼ cup buttermilk (60 mL)
2 tsp. pure vanilla extract
2½ cups all-purpose flour, unbleached (312 g)
1 tsp. baking soda
1 tsp. baking powder
1 tsp. sea salt

Cream Cheese Frosting:
8 oz cream cheese, softened (225 g)
½ cup unsalted butter, softened (113 g)
1 tsp. pure vanilla extract
½ tsp. sea salt
2½ cups Monk Fruit Sweetener with Erythritol (Powdered) (315 g)
1 Tbsp. heavy cream

Topping:
½ cup walnuts, chopped

Preheat oven to 350°F (180°C/160°C fan, Gas Mark 4). Grease and flour a 9x13" (approximately 23x33cm) baking pan. Set aside.

Combine butter and sugars in the bowl of a stand mixer (or in a large bowl and use an electric mixer). Beat until well-combined and light and fluffy.

Add oil and beat to combine. Stir in mashed bananas. Add eggs, buttermilk, and vanilla extract and stir until well-combined.

In a separate bowl, stir together flour, baking soda, baking powder and salt.

Gradually the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ients until completely combined.

Spread batter into the prepared pan and bake for 45-55 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out mostly clean with few moist crumbs. Allow to cool completely before covering with frosting.

For the Cream Cheese Frosting:
Combine cream cheese, butter, vanilla extract and salt in a large bowl and beat with an electric mixer until creamy.

With mixer on low-speed, gradually add the powdered sugar until completely combined.

Add heavy cream and gradually increase speed to high. Beat on high for 30 seconds.

Spread over completely cooled banana cake. Top with chopped walnuts (if using). Slice and serve.

Makes 8-10 servings.


Cook's Notes:

  • Keep an eye on your banana cake as it bakes. 30 minutes in, check your cake to see if it's becoming too brown on top (pay attention to the edges, if they're getting darker in color and pulling away from the edges), if so you may lightly tent with foil before baking the remaining 15 minutes. I had this issue when baking in a glass dish but not in a metal one (which was the opposite of what I expected).
  • Storage: I store my cake in the pan that I baked it in, covered. It will keep at room temperature for up to 3 days or in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to a week.
